Output 262931e9ba6a13e1486a85468bc6af3034a9fc094611994c7e9ea8d4cc7cd656:0

value
651075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 337cc678e5ad15c84be027cb0ac234c17ee1ea2a OP_EQUAL
address
36PFrsAUf6nK6VJ9stah6Bwn94ynkxV5i4
transaction
262931e9ba6a13e1486a85468bc6af3034a9fc094611994c7e9ea8d4cc7cd656
confirmations
521997
spent
true